View File

@@ -0,0 +1,67 @@
<?php
namespace Combodo\iTop\Test\UnitTest\Core;
use Combodo\iTop\Test\UnitTest\ItopTestCase;
use Config;
use DateTime;
/**
* @runTestsInSeparateProcesses
* @preserveGlobalState disabled
* @backupGlobals disabled
*
* @package Combodo\iTop\Test\UnitTest\Core
*/
class WeeklyScheduledProcessTest extends ItopTestCase
{
protected function setUp()
{
parent::setUp();
require_once(APPROOT.'core/backgroundprocess.inc.php');
require_once(APPROOT.'test/core/WeeklyScheduledProcessMockConfig.php');
}
/**
* @dataProvider GetNextOccurrenceProvider
* @test
*
* @param boolean $bEnabledValue true if task is enabled
* @param string $sCurrentTime Date string for current time, eg '2020-01-01 23:30'
* @param string $sTimeValue time to run that is set in the config, eg '23:30'
* @param string $sExpectedTime next occurrence that should be returned
*
* @throws \ProcessInvalidConfigException
*/
public function TestGetNextOccurrence($bEnabledValue, $sCurrentTime, $sTimeValue, $sExpectedTime)
{
$oWeeklyImpl = new \WeeklyScheduledProcessMockConfig($bEnabledValue, $sTimeValue);
$sItopTimeZone = $oWeeklyImpl->getOConfig()->Get('timezone');
$timezone = new \DateTimeZone($sItopTimeZone);
$oExpectedDateTime = new DateTime($sExpectedTime, $timezone);
$this->assertEquals($oExpectedDateTime, $oWeeklyImpl->GetNextOccurrence($sCurrentTime));
}
public function GetNextOccurrenceProvider()
{
return array(
'Disabled process' => array(false, 'now', null, '3000-01-01'),
'working day same day, prog noon and current before noon' => array(true, '2020-05-11 11:00', '12:00', '2020-05-11 12:00'),
'working day same day, prog noon and current is noon' => array(true, '2020-05-11 12:00', '12:00', '2020-05-12 12:00'),
'working day same day, prog noon and current after noon' => array(true, '2020-05-11 13:00', '12:00', '2020-05-12 12:00'),
'saturday, prog noon and current before noon' => array(true, '2020-05-09 11:00', '12:00', '2020-05-11 12:00'),
'saturday, prog noon and current is noon' => array(true, '2020-05-09 12:00', '12:00', '2020-05-11 12:00'),
'saturday, prog noon and current after noon' => array(true, '2020-05-09 13:00', '12:00', '2020-05-11 12:00'),
'sunday, prog noon and current before noon' => array(true, '2020-05-10 11:00', '12:00', '2020-05-11 12:00'),
'sunday, prog noon and current is noon' => array(true, '2020-05-10 12:00', '12:00', '2020-05-11 12:00'),
'sunday, prog noon and current after noon' => array(true, '2020-05-10 13:00', '12:00', '2020-05-11 12:00'),
'working day, day before, prog noon and current before midnight' => array(true, '2020-05-11 23:59', '00:00', '2020-05-12 00:00'),
'working day same day, prog noon and current is midnight' => array(true, '2020-05-12 00:00', '00:00', '2020-05-13 00:00'),
'working day same day, prog noon and current after midnight' => array(true, '2020-05-12 00:01', '00:00', '2020-05-13 00:00'),
);
}
}
